游乐游手机版
首页/编程语言/文章详情

java在线教程 无法使用怎么办?常见问题排查

时间:2026-04-20 06:22
网络连接与访问环境检查当在线教程无法正常使用时,首先应检查基础的网络连接状况。确保您的设备已成功接入互联网,可以尝试打开其他网站或服务来验证网络是否通畅。有时,问题可能源于特定的网络环境限制,例如公司或学校的防火墙可能会屏蔽某些教育或视频平台。在这种情况下,可以尝试切换网络,比如从公司Wi-Fi切换

网络连接与访问环境检查

当在线教程无法正常使用时,首先应检查基础的网络连接状况。确保您的设备已成功接入互联网,可以尝试打开其他网站或服务来验证网络是否通畅。有时,问题可能源于特定的网络环境限制,例如公司或学校的防火墙可能会屏蔽某些教育或视频平台。在这种情况下,可以尝试切换网络,比如从公司Wi-Fi切换到个人移动热点,看是否能恢复访问。

java在线教程 无法使用怎么办?常见问题排查

此外,浏览器本身的状态也至关重要。清除浏览器缓存和Cookie是解决许多页面加载问题的有效方法。长期积累的缓存数据可能导致页面渲染错误或脚本冲突。同时,检查浏览器是否禁用了JavaScript,因为绝大多数现代在线教程平台都依赖JavaScript来实现交互功能。如果问题依然存在,可以尝试使用无痕模式访问,或更换其他浏览器(如Chrome、Firefox、Edge)进行测试,以排除浏览器扩展插件冲突的可能性。

平台服务状态与兼容性问题

在线教程平台本身可能出现临时性的服务中断或维护。您可以访问该平台官方的社交媒体账号(如微博、Twitter)或状态页面,查看是否有关于服务故障的公告。有时,问题可能仅出现在特定课程或视频上,这可能是由于该资源被移除、设置为私有,或者存在临时的编码错误。

另一个常见原因是设备或浏览器与平台的技术要求不兼容。许多在线学习平台会逐步淘汰对旧版本浏览器的支持。请确保您的浏览器已更新至最新稳定版。对于涉及代码编辑或运行环境的交互式教程,平台可能需要特定的系统权限或插件支持。请仔细阅读教程页面的“系统要求”或“准备工作”部分,确认您的操作系统版本、浏览器类型及版本、以及是否安装了必要的运行环境(如某些Java Web Start应用可能需要特定版本的JRE)。

账户权限与内容访问限制

部分高质量的Java在线教程内容可能需要用户登录账户才能访问,尤其是涉及练习、测验或项目代码的部分。请确认您已使用正确的账户凭据登录。如果您是通过第三方链接(如搜索引擎结果、论坛分享链接)直接访问某个具体章节,有时会因权限验证失败而无法加载。尝试从平台主页登录后,再通过课程目录导航至目标内容。

订阅模式也是需要考虑的因素。一些平台采用免费与付费内容结合的商业模式。您当前无法访问的教程章节可能属于付费专区。检查您的账户订阅状态,确认该课程是否包含在您已购买的服务套餐内。有时,平台会提供有限的免费试看,超出试看范围后内容会被锁定。

本地运行环境配置问题

对于需要动手实践的Java教程,问题可能不在于观看视频,而在于无法在本地成功运行示例代码。这通常与本地开发环境配置有关。首先,确认您已在计算机上正确安装了Java开发工具包(JDK),而不仅仅是Java运行时环境(JRE)。可以通过在命令行终端输入“java -version”和“javac -version”来验证安装和版本。

环境变量PATH和JAVA_HOME的设置是初学者常遇的障碍。如果系统找不到Java命令,通常是因为PATH变量未包含JDK的bin目录路径。请根据您的操作系统(Windows、macOS、Linux)查找相应的环境变量配置教程进行修正。此外,如果您使用的是集成开发环境(IDE)如IntelliJ IDEA或Eclipse,请确保IDE中配置的JDK路径与系统安装的版本一致。

代码问题与寻求帮助的途径

如果教程中的示例代码在您的环境中无法编译或运行,错误可能出在代码本身或您的理解上。仔细核对代码是否完全按照教程所示输入,注意大小写、分号、括号匹配等细节。初学者容易忽略的缩进和空格有时也会导致问题。利用IDE的代码错误提示功能,它能帮助您快速定位语法错误。

当自行排查无法解决问题时,积极寻求外部帮助是高效的学习方式。大多数教程平台都设有课程讨论区或问答社区,您可以在相应章节下描述您遇到的问题、错误信息、已尝试的步骤以及您的环境配置,通常会有讲师、助教或其他学员提供解答。此外,将具体的错误信息复制到通用的技术问答社区或搜索引擎中查找,往往能找到解决方案。记住,清晰地描述问题是将获得有效帮助的关键。

来源:news_generate:6201
上一篇Composer如何配置auth.json认证文件_Composer auth.json认证文件配置技巧 下一篇java在线教程 实操记录:从安装到正常使用
本站内容用于信息整理与展示,如有侵权或内容问题请及时联系处理。

相关推荐

补充同频道和同主题内容,方便继续浏览更多相关内容。

同类最新

继续查看同栏目最近更新的文章。

更多
如何在ThinkPHP中实现定时任务与命令行调度方法
编程语言 · 2026-07-04

如何在ThinkPHP中实现定时任务与命令行调度方法

用ThinkPHP实现定时任务时,很多开发者第一步就卡在命令行报错上,直接输入php think your:command却无法识别——这种情况绝大多数是因为命令类的注册方式存在问题。下面先梳理几个核心要点。 ThinkPHP 6 中 think 命令如何正确触发自定义指令 直接运行 php thi

ThinkPHP API接口防重放攻击实现方法
编程语言 · 2026-07-04

ThinkPHP API接口防重放攻击实现方法

先说几个核心判断:API防重放攻击这件事,做对了是道防火墙,做错了就是个心理安慰。很多开发者到踩坑了才明白——验签这东西,放错位置、漏掉字段、存错nonce,每一环都能让整个安全体系直接归零。 验签必须放在中间件里,不能在控制器里写 ThinkPHP 的请求生命周期中,中间件是唯一能在路由匹配、参数

ThinkPHP文件上传必须验证扩展名安全必要性分析
编程语言 · 2026-07-04

ThinkPHP文件上传必须验证扩展名安全必要性分析

在使用ThinkPHP进行文件上传时,ext扩展名验证通常是开发者首先接触的关键环节。但你真的了解它的实际工作原理吗?它仅比对文件名后缀,而不读取文件内容,甚至对空格和大小写都极其敏感。更为重要的是——它是TP文件上传验证五层防线中不可忽视的第一道关卡,一旦配置遗漏,整个validate验证链将直接

ThinkPHP关联模型自动写入与更新使用教程
编程语言 · 2026-07-04

ThinkPHP关联模型自动写入与更新使用教程

需要明确的是,ThinkPHP关联模型并没有提供所谓的“自动写入 更新”魔法开关。所谓的“自动”功能,实际上都需要开发者手动编写配置逻辑才能生效。核心原则在于:主模型和从模型必须分开独立处理,时间戳字段和业务字段需依靠修改器或钩子接管;批量操作则要规规矩矩地绕过模型逻辑来执行——只有理解透彻这些要点

BoxLayout中仅居中一个组件其他默认左对齐
编程语言 · 2026-07-04

BoxLayout中仅居中一个组件其他默认左对齐

在 Java Swing 中使用 BoxLayout 的 Y_AXIS 方向布局时,很多初学者容易掉进一个常见陷阱:希望将某个组件单独设置为中心对齐,但当调用 `setAlignmentX(CENTER_ALIGNMENT)` 后,却发现其他组件也跟着发生了偏移,完全达不到预期效果。实际上,关键之处